Case Study: The Impact of The Born This Way Foundation

Lady Gaga started her foundation back in 2012. It’s named Born This Way. Its main goal is to help young people thrive. It also works to raise mental health awareness everywhere. This project is a perfect example. Gaga uses her fame for positive change. She creates something real and impactful. That’s pretty inspiring, isn’t it? The foundation provides resources. They are designed to help young people specifically. Mental wellness is a key focus. Self-acceptance is big too. They also encourage community support efforts.

NAMI, the National Alliance on Mental Illness, reported something concerning. One in five young people struggle. They have a mental health condition of some kind. (NAMI, 2022). Gaga’s foundation really tries to tackle this problem head-on. It gives young people a space. They can talk about their struggles openly. That is huge for breaking down stigma. Their programs have reached thousands of young people. They really emphasize mental health education. Self-care is also highlighted constantly. It genuinely helps many individuals.

Historical Context and Evolving Celebrity Roles

It’s interesting to look back a bit. The way celebrities interact with fans has changed so much. Think about earlier eras. There was more distance, more mystery in a different way. Fans saw stars on screen or stage. Now, social media lets you peek behind the curtain. Celebrities like Gaga kind of bridge these worlds. She keeps some mystique but also shares deeply. This shift mirrors how society talks about things. Things like mental health, especially. Not long ago, talking about it was taboo. Celebrities speaking up has helped change that conversation.

Consider the historical role of artists. They’ve often challenged norms. They’ve pushed boundaries. They’ve reflected society, too. Now, some artists are using their voice differently. They’re becoming advocates. They use their platform for social causes. Mental health is a major one now. This wasn’t common even 20 years ago. Gaga was one of the early, big voices in this space. She used her own story powerfully. This honestly paved the way for others. It showed that fans were ready for this kind of honesty.

Perspectives and Counterarguments

Of course, not everyone sees celebrity advocacy the same way. Some people are a bit skeptical. They wonder if it’s just for show. Is it just good publicity? That’s a valid question, sometimes. Critics might argue that sharing struggles online isn’t the same. It’s not the same as real, systemic support. They might say it doesn’t fix root problems. Like lack of access to affordable therapy. Or issues in the healthcare system.

That said, it seems to me that genuine efforts like Gaga’s matter. A celebrity speaking out reaches people. It reaches them who might never see a therapist. Or read a mental health pamphlet. It can be a first step. It can reduce shame. It can make someone feel less alone. A quote from Dr. Ken Duckworth of NAMI comes to mind. He’s the Chief Medical Officer there. He’s said that hearing someone you admire talk about mental illness… it can be incredibly validating for people struggling themselves. It shows it’s not a moral failing. It’s a health issue. So while advocacy isn’t a cure-all, it absolutely serves a vital purpose. It opens doors.
